Brandon Expands Client Services Team with Two New Hires

Brandon, an integrated data-driven, digitally-centric marketing firm specializing in B2B, healthcare, financial services, telecommunications, outdoor lifestyles, lifestyle apparel, travel and tourism, consumer packaged goods, real estate, utilities, and fitness categories, has added two trailblazers, Megan Galage and Ben Crimminger, to the client services team.

Megan Galage is Brandon’s newest account manager. She will be building and maintaining strong and effective working relationships with current clients through managing budgets, billing, approving all internal client work, and leading the strategic planning of programs and projects. Galage has 5 years of account management experience in the education, retail, and financial industries. She graduated from the University of Kentucky, with a bachelor’s degree in integrated strategic communication, marketing and account management.

Ben Crimminger joins the agency as a project manager out of the Charleston, S.C. office. He will manage all client-approved projects to completion, including developing and executing timelines, budgets, reports, and creative and interactive development. Crimminger has experience in agencies and managing marketing efforts for venues. In his previous role, he developed successful campaigns for government agencies throughout the pandemic. Crimminger earned a bachelor’s degree from the University of South Carolina, where he majored in advertising and minored in business administration.

“We are so excited to add Megan and Ben to the client services team,” said Christie DeAntonio, Director of Client Services at Brandon. “Our team is growing rapidly, and adding new talent allows us to continue to build marketing campaigns that drive success for our clients.”
